103.88.159.0/24

No:726, 1st Floor 38th Cross, 4 th T Block,Jayanagar - Updated 16 Jan 2026 22:13 Fri

Network Description: No:726, 1st Floor 38th Cross, 4 th T Block,Jayanagar
Prefix Description Country